The building is a historic Art Nouveau villa constructed between 1903 and 1904, designed by the architects Alexander Neumann, Rudolf Baumfeld, and Norbert Schlesinger. It represents an important example of early 20th-century design and serves as a cultural heritage site. The villa's architectural style features the characteristic elegance and ornamental details typical of the Jugendstil movement.
Functioning as a museum, the villa offers exhibitions that explore the history of the local bourgeoisie families, specifically the Löw-Beer and Tugendhat families, as well as regional Jewish history. These exhibitions provide insight into the social and cultural context of the time, enriching understanding of the area's heritage.
The museum also hosts cultural events and includes a gallery space situated in the villa's garden. The site is wheelchair accessible, making it inclusive for a wide audience. Its status as a hidden gem highlights its significance as a cultural venue and architectural treasure.
